When it comes to selecting a suitable location for your shelter, there are several factors to consider. First and foremost, look for flat ground that is free from potential hazards like falling rocks or branches. Avoid low-lying areas or places prone to flooding as they can become waterlogged during heavy rainfall. It’s also important to take into account the direction of prevailing winds; positioning your shelter in a way that blocks strong gusts can significantly increase its effectiveness in protecting you from the elements.

Next, let’s talk about materials. Depending on the environment you find yourself in, different natural resources may be available for constructing your shelter. In forested areas, fallen branches and leaves can be used to create a sturdy framework for your shelter. If near a body of water, driftwood or other washed-up debris can be utilized. In more arid regions, rocks or even sandbags can be employed as building materials.

Understanding different shelter types is crucial as well. Lean-tos are one of the simplest and most versatile options; they consist of a slanted roof supported by two poles with one end resting on the ground and the other elevated off the ground using additional support sticks. Debris huts involve creating a framework using larger branches and covering it with smaller sticks, leaves, moss, or any other available natural material for insulation. Tarp shelters are another popular choice due to their portability and ease of setup; simply suspend a waterproof tarp between trees or use trekking poles as supports.

Lastly, incorporating insulation is important for retaining body heat within your shelter. Layering natural materials like leaves or pine needles on the ground can provide a cushioning effect and act as an insulating barrier. Adding additional layers of branches or other materials to the walls and roof of your shelter can also help trap warm air inside.

Remember, building a shelter is not only about protection from the elements but also ensuring your safety. Always inspect your chosen location for potential hazards like dead trees or insect nests. Additionally, ensure that your shelter allows for proper ventilation to prevent condensation buildup and improve air quality.

Choosing the right location

Choosing the right location is crucial when it comes to building a shelter in a survival or camping situation. The success and effectiveness of your shelter will greatly depend on where you choose to set up camp. To illustrate this point, let’s consider an example: Imagine you are stranded in a dense forest during a heavy rainstorm. In this scenario, finding higher ground surrounded by sturdy trees would be ideal as it offers protection from both flooding and falling debris.

When selecting a suitable location for your shelter, there are several factors to take into consideration. First and foremost, ensure that the area is not prone to flooding or standing water accumulation. Choosing elevated ground will help prevent water seepage into your shelter and keep you dry throughout the night. Additionally, be mindful of potential hazards such as loose rocks or steep slopes nearby, which could pose risks if they were to collapse onto your shelter.

Gathering suitable materials

After identifying the ideal location for your shelter, it is crucial to gather suitable materials that will ensure its stability and durability. Let’s consider a hypothetical scenario where you find yourself in a dense forest with limited resources but an urgent need for shelter.

To begin, assess the surrounding area for natural materials that can be utilized effectively. In this case, fallen branches and tree trunks provide excellent options as they are readily available and offer structural strength. Look for dry wood that is sturdy yet flexible enough to withstand external pressures such as wind or rain. Additionally, leaves and foliage scattered on the ground can serve as effective insulation when layered properly within the structure.

Once you have identified the necessary materials, here are some key considerations to keep in mind:

  • Size: Collect pieces of varying sizes to accommodate different parts of your shelter.
  • Quality: Ensure that the gathered materials are free from rot or decay which may compromise the integrity of your shelter.
  • Quantity: Gather more materials than initially estimated, taking into account potential breakages or weaknesses in certain pieces.
  • Versatility: Select materials that allow for flexibility during construction so that adjustments can be made if needed.

Waterproofing your shelter

Imagine you’ve built a sturdy framework for your shelter, but now it’s time to ensure that it can withstand the elements. Waterproofing is crucial to protect yourself from rain, snow, and other forms of moisture that could compromise your comfort and safety in the wilderness.

One effective method of waterproofing is by using tarps or plastic sheeting. These materials are lightweight, easy to carry, and provide excellent protection against water penetration. For instance, let’s consider a hypothetical scenario where you’re camping near a lake and heavy rain is forecasted. By covering your shelter with a tarp secured tightly around the edges, you can create a barrier between the interior of your structure and the outside world.

To further enhance the effectiveness of your waterproofing efforts, here are some additional tips:

  • Apply seam sealer: Seam sealer is specifically designed to seal any gaps or seams in tents or tarps. Applying this product along stitching lines will help prevent water from seeping into your shelter.
  • Elevate the floor: If possible, elevate the floor of your shelter slightly above ground level. This helps prevent groundwater from entering during heavy rainfall.
  • Use waterproof spray: Consider treating fabric surfaces with a waterproof spray like silicone-based products. This adds an extra layer of protection against moisture infiltration.
  • Avoid low-lying areas: When choosing a location for setting up your shelter, avoid areas prone to flooding or pooling water. Select higher ground whenever possible.

Adding insulation for warmth

Imagine you’re out camping in the wilderness during a chilly autumn night. The temperature has dropped significantly, and you find yourself shivering inside your shelter despite being protected from the elements. This scenario highlights the importance of adding insulation to your shelter to stay warm and comfortable throughout your outdoor adventure.

To effectively insulate your shelter and prevent heat loss, consider implementing the following strategies:

  1. Use natural materials: Utilize nature’s resources by incorporating insulating materials found in the environment. Dried leaves, pine needles, or straw can be used as filler between layers of your shelter to provide additional insulation and trap body heat.

  2. Create air pockets: Air is an excellent thermal insulator; therefore, creating air pockets within your shelter can help retain warmth. Consider using blankets or sleeping bags that have built-in insulation properties or create layers with space in-between them to maximize this effect.

  3. Optimize ventilation: While it may seem counterintuitive, proper ventilation plays a crucial role in maintaining a warm and dry shelter. Good airflow helps eliminate excess moisture caused by condensation while allowing fresh air intake. Be sure not to completely seal off your shelter as it could lead to dampness and discomfort.

  4. Invest in insulation products: If you frequently engage in outdoor activities requiring overnight stays, investing in specialized insulation products might be worthwhile. Sleeping pads made of closed-cell foam or inflatable mats designed specifically for cold weather camping provide excellent thermal protection against the ground’s chill.
